IT Manager

Haystack · Switzerland
<br/> <!-- --> <!-- --> <!-- --> <div> <!-- --> <div> <br/> <div> We're working with a leading technology company that specializes in innovative solutions for various industries. This organization is known for its modern approach, agile decision-making, and commitment to fostering a collaborative and supportive work environment.<br/><br/>The Role<br/><br/><ul><li> Oversee all IT operations at the Einsiedeln site, ensuring alignment with corporate guidelines</li><li> Guarantee the avail…
Apply on original site
← Browse all jobs on Jobich.ch